The continuum of pulmonary developmental anomalies
D M Panicek1, E R Heitzman, P A Randall
1Department of Radiology, SUNY Health Science Center, Syracuse 13210.
Summary
This study details common pulmonary developmental anomalies and highlights overlapping cases, suggesting they exist on a continuum. Understanding this spectrum is key for accurate classification and future research into lung development.

Background:
- Pulmonary developmental anomalies are congenital conditions affecting lung formation.
- Accurate classification is crucial for diagnosis and management.
- Understanding the embryological basis aids in identifying these anomalies.
Observation:
- Classic features of six common pulmonary developmental anomalies were presented.
- Illustrations of overlap cases demonstrated features of multiple anomalies simultaneously.
- These cases challenge discrete classification systems.
Findings:
- Pulmonary developmental anomalies present as a spectrum or continuum.
- Overlap cases indicate that distinct categories may not fully capture the variations.
- The pathogenesis of these anomalies requires further elucidation.
Implications:
- The continuum concept refines the understanding of pulmonary developmental anomalies.
- Future research in pulmonary embryology may improve classification and understanding of pathogenesis.
- This work aids clinicians in diagnosing and managing complex cases.
